字符串日期格式化方法详解:从CDate到SimpleDateFormat

创始人
2024-12-15 16:36:02
0 次浏览
0 评论

如何将字符串转化为日期

format(cdate(x),"yyyy-m-d")cdate是转换函数functionFormatDateTime(constFormat:string;DateTime:TDateTime):string;overload;当然还有另外一个类似Format的,不过这里我们只介绍第一个泛型使用的Format参数是格式字符串。
DateTime是一种时间类型。
返回值是一个格式化的字符串。
重点关注Format参数中的命令字符c,以短时间格式显示时间,即所有数字表示FormatdateTime('c',now);8-79:55:40d对应于一天中的小时。
如果日期是一位数,则显示一位数,如果日期是两位数,则显示两位数。
我('d',现在);输出可以是1~31dd,与d含义相同,但始终显示为两位数。
格式日期时间('dd',现在);星期几FormatdateTime('ddd',now);输出为:第七个dddd和ddd显示相同。
但以上两件事在其他国家可能会有所不同。
ddddd以短时间格式显示年、月、日FormatdateTime('ddddd',now);结果是:2004-8-7dddddd以长时间格式显示年、月和日FormatdateTime('dddddd',now);输出为:August20047Datee/ee/eee/eeee显示相应数字的年份FormatdateTime('ee',now);结果是:04(代表04年)m/mm/mmm/mmmm代表月份FormatdateTime('m',now););输出为:8FormatdateTime('mm',now);输出为08FormatdateTime('mmm',now);输出为AugustFormatdateTime('mmmm',now);输出为August与ddd/dddd相同,可能不同其他地区国家表yy/yyyy表示年份。
FormatdateTime('yy',现在);输出为04FormatdateTime('yyyy',now);输出为2004h/hh、n/nn、s/ss、z/zzz分别代表小时、分钟、秒。
、毫秒和t短时间格式显示timeFormatdateTime('t',now);输出为10:17tt。
以长格式显示时间FormatdateTime('tt',now);输出为10:18:46ampm。
-术语格式。
FormatdateTime('ttampm',现在);结果是:上午10:22:57。
如果要将常规字符串添加到格式中,可以使用引号来分隔那些特殊定义的字符。
,如果正则字符串包含特殊字符,则不会以时间格式显示:FormatdateTime('"todayis"c',now);输出为:Todayis2004-8-710:26:58您还可以在时间中添加“-”或“\”来分隔日期:FormatdateTime('"todayis"yy-mm-dd',nowhour);FormatdateTime('"今天是"yy\mm\dd',now);输出为:Todayis04-08-07您还可以使用://FormatdateTime('"todayis"hh:nn:ss',now);结果是:今天10:32:23

jsp中字符串转换成日期函数

只需将其转换为符合格式的字符串SimpleDateFormat("yyyy-MM-dd"Stringd=dd.format(newDate());dd");Dated=dd.parse("2008/07/22");

excel怎么把字符串转化为日期格式

TEXT功能完成

热门文章
1
C语言字符串常量解析:区别、用途及存储方... 什么是字符串常量字符串常量是C语言中的一种数据类型,它是由一对双引号括起来的字符...

2
C语言printf函数:格式字符串与输出... printf函数中的格式与输出项有什么关系?在C语言中,printf函数中的格式...

3
Excel技巧:计算字符串起始位置与合并... 如何计算字符串在特定文本中的起始位置,怎么计算字符串在特定文本中的起始位置您可以...

4
Python发音全解:掌握正确的发音方法... python怎么读我的很多学习编程的朋友可能都知道Python这个词,但是他们中...

5
字符与字符串:编程中的基础文本类型解析 字符串什么意思字符串是由数字、字母和下划线组成的字符串,表示为s=“a1a2…a...

6
Python编程语言:多领域应用与开发优... Python的作用是什么?Python是一种跨平台计算机编程语言,是ABC语言的...

7
深度解析:C语言编程特点与应用领域 什么叫c语言C语言是一种编程语言。C编程语言应用广泛,具有以下特点和特点:1.语...

8
Java全解析:跨平台编程语言的魅力与多... java是什么Java是一种功能强大的编程语言,被称为“一次编写,随处运行”模型...

9
C语言字符串长度与内存占用解析:空字符与... 内存中的长度在C中,字符串的长度和字符串在内存中占用的字节数是两个概念。(1)长...

10
Excel文本转数值技巧:5种方法轻松转... excel怎么将字符串转为数值1.使用VALUE函数将字符数字转换为数字。VAL...